Профессия — 1С » Сравнение регистров в разных базах

Профессия — 1С

Рукопашный бой Карташ

Категории

-->

Сравнение регистров в разных базах

рубрики: Регистры | Дата: 3 января, 2016

Иногда возникает необходимость сравнить записи в регистрах, которые находятся в разных базах. Как начинают решать такую задачу программисты? Как вариант — это COM соединение из одной базы к другой, с последующим запросом к регистрам в двух базах и сравнение результатов запросов. Но иногда полезно отбросить тип мышления программиста и найти более простой путь.

В данном случае можно воспользоваться следующим алгоритмом:

  • В косоли запросов делаем запрос к регистру с упорядочиванием по необходимым полям.
  • Выполняем запросы в обоих базах. Результаты сохраняем в файлы *.mxl
  • Идем в меню «Файл» – > «Сравнить файлы» (можно как в режиме предприятия так и в конфигураторе). Выбираем ранее сохраненные файлы и смотрим на результат сравнения

Думаю, что для данной задачи это самый простой вариант.

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*

   

2014 - 2024г. Профессия — 1С. Обмен опытом по программированию в 1С